Artificial General Intelligence (AGI) and The Future of Mankind

 

Have you ever imagined what might be like for a machine to see, experience and interact with its immediate surroundings in the world at large in the same way that people do. That is precisely what artificial general Intelligence (AGI), the pinnacle of AI and processor to the god like idea of super intelligence may enable machines and software programs to perform artificial general Intelligence, a concept that yet to be realized will think and carry out complex tasks such as corporate restructuring and HR management using human characteristics such as logical reasoning empathy and human centeredness while maintaining the expected computational speed, accuracy and big data analytics associated with standard AI applications.



Although the capabilities of the upgraded technology are relatively well known, understanding the precise distinctions between it and AI is required to understand why we may not see AGI in the near future or ever. In this article we will discuss the possibility of an artificial general intelligence emerging and if it does; what it could mean for the future of society.

Essentially AI is considerably more reliant on collected data than and AGI-based application. Normal AI tools, cognitive capacities are quite restricted. These tools primarily use machine learning data for problem solving, analytics driven decision making and other tasks such as language recognition and generation (NLP, NLG), facial recognition, computer vision, smart parking management via proximity sensors and lighting sensors and variety of other applications. AI based apps are one dimensional and can accomplish the tasks for which their algorithmic models have been trained with accuracy and efficacy.


In terms of functionality, the models and algorithms in artificial general intelligence are far more diverse. Their intelligence is several levels higher than that of AI tools. If and when it arrives, AGI imbues robots with uncanny human-like behavior and presence. Consider this, an AI based robot can clean house floors, handle laundry for the week or conduct similar activities. An AGI powered robot can perform all of this while also remembering an individual schedule before entering their room locating the proper ingredients and brewing the ideal cup of coffee for them. AGI is thus a highly advanced kind of AI. At the moment there are several issues that may stymie the construction and development of AGI. As previously said, AGI applications are designed to flawlessly duplicate human awareness and cognitive skills, however AGI researchers are unable to generate Neural Networks capable of simulating artificial consciousness in the lab at least not yet. Human consciousness is too abstract and asymmetrical to be modeled by a Turing machine for AGI construction. To reproduce human consciousness in an AGI model, one method would be to represent the brain as a quantum computer capable of solving problems in polynomial time with row processing power alone. While this would considerably improve an algorithm’s performance and efficiency, it would not be the path to designing computers with awareness and their own individual human personalities. The halting problem is another issue with employing programs and code. This notion argues that any computer program will at some point in time exhibit functionality issues and finally stop executing for specific inputs. This is a problem that may have no answers with Turing’s investigations indicating that there isn’t an algorithm that can solve it in general.


This raises significant concerns about the long-term usefulness and computability of AGI based technologies. AGI developers will need to teach AGI algorithms the idea of human ethics in order to prevent the types of misunderstanding observed above. However, this is easier said than done. Because there is no precedence for adding morality into AGI models. Consider a circumstance which several patients require medical attention and resources are limited. How will an AGI-based applications make judgements in such a situation. Perhaps in the future machine learning will be able to learn moral conduct. 

However, there is a large if! Because implementing AGI is to hazardous if key judgements are made without taking the human side of things into account. Despite their limitations, humans can clearly distinguish between good and wrong. Preventing that anything goes approach from being applied during vital decision making if the notion of AGI becomes a reality in the near or far future. Models and applications must include elements such as empathy, compassion and civilized reasoning. Until then the notion of AGI appears to be a long way from real world applications.
